You should be able to read a gmpl file into Cbc (If GMPL installed
using ThirdParty). The format is something like<br>
<br>
cbc -import gmpl_model_file%gmpl_data_file -solve<br>
<br>
The code may be broken if nobody has used the facility for years
but should be easy to fix.<br>

<p class="MsoNormal">i am learning CBC in order to transition to
it from GLPK.<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">Since I cannot lose GMPL’s capabilities but
for various reasons I am constrained to use the unmodified
executable, my modus operandi is<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">1) run GLPK with the “--wlp model.lp
--check" option to make the mod-> lp transition<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">2) run cbc solving the .lp model<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">I would like to know, is there a way to
pass the model to be solved via the console standard input? My
models (all integer) get pretty big pretty fast, and I am
concerned I might use a huge amount of disk space that I then
need to clean up, while this could all be avoided if I could
feed the model to cbc in memory.<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><o:p> </o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">If i was not clear, what I want to
accomplish in GLPK can be done like this (language is C#, i am
on Windows 7):<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><o:p> </o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"> System.Diagnostics.Process
process = new System.Diagnostics.Process();<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">
process.StartInfo.UseShellExecute = false;<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"> process.StartInfo.FileName =
glpsolPath; <o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"> process.StartInfo.Arguments =
String.Format("--math /dev/stdin --output {0} --log {1}",
outputStreamPath, logPath);<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">
process.StartInfo.RedirectStandardInput = true;<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"> process.Start();<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"> StreamReader tr = new
StreamReader(modelPath);<o:p></o:p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">
process.StandardInput.Write(tr.ReadToEnd());<o:p></o:p></p>
